Martine Carol
Martine Carol , of her true name Marie-Louise Jeanne Nicole Mourer , French actress, born the May 16th 1920 with Saint-Mandé, the Valley-of-Marne, deceased the February 6th 1967 with Monte Carlo, Monaco.
